Pasta Primavera

This dish pairs nicely with lean grilled chicken. Add chickpeas or black beans for a meatless meal. Other vegetables that would work in this recipe include zucchini, squash, mushrooms, and sugar peas. 

Total Time: 30 minutes

Servings: 5

 

Ingredients

  • 10 oz. dry whole wheat pasta of your choice
  • 1 Tbsp. olive oil
  • ½ medium onion, sliced
  • 1 large carrot, peeled and sliced into matchsticks
  • 2 cups of broccoli florets, sliced into matchsticks
  • 2 medium red or orange bell peppers, sliced into matchsticks
  • 2 tsp. minced garlic
  • 1 cup grape tomatoes, halved
  • 1 Tbsp. Italian seasoning
  • 2 Tbsp. lemon juice
  • ½ cup shredded parmesan

Instructions

  1.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Cook pasta according to package directions until tender.
  2. While pasta is cooking, he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at.
  3. Add red onion and carrots. Sauté for 3 minutes.
  4. Add broccoli and bell pepper. Sauté for 2-3 minutes.   
  5. Add garlic, tomatoes, and Italian seasoning. Sauté for 3 more minutes until veggies are tender and easily pierced with a fork.
  6. Remove veggies from heat and pour into serving bowl. Drain pasta and add to the serving bowl with veggies. Drizzle with lemon juice and sprinkle with parmesan cheese.
